What to Expect: Tips for Your Best Gun Show Experience
So, you've got the Leesburg Armory Gun Show Schedule 2024 locked in, and you're ready to hit the show floor. Awesome! But before you dive in, let's talk strategy. To make sure you have the absolute best experience possible, a little preparation goes a long way, guys. First things first: know what you're looking for. Are you on the hunt for a specific model of handgun, a particular rifle caliber, or perhaps some unique reloading components? Having a target in mind will help you navigate the sea of vendors more efficiently and prevent you from getting sidetracked by impulse buys (though, hey, sometimes those are the best finds!). Make a list, do some online research beforehand about prices and common issues for items you're interested in. This will equip you with the knowledge to spot a good deal and avoid a lemon. Next up: budgeting. Gun shows can be a financial black hole if you're not careful. Decide beforehand how much you're willing to spend and stick to it. Bring cash! Many vendors offer better prices for cash transactions, and it’s a tangible way to keep track of your spending. Having exact change or smaller bills can also speed up transactions. Now, let's talk about what to bring. Comfortable shoes are non-negotiable. You'll be doing a lot of walking and standing. Wear layers, as the temperature inside the venue can fluctuate. A small, comfortable bag or backpack can be useful for carrying purchases, but be mindful of venue restrictions on bag size. Safety first, always. While these shows are generally safe and well-managed, it’s crucial to be aware of your surroundings. Treat every firearm as if it were loaded, and never handle a gun without the vendor's explicit permission. Follow all posted rules and regulations. Don't be afraid to haggle. Negotiation is part of the gun show culture. Be polite, do your homework on fair market value, and make a reasonable offer. You might be surprised at how often vendors are willing to work with you, especially if you're buying multiple items. Finally, talk to people! Engage with the vendors, ask questions, share your knowledge. You'll learn a ton, meet great people, and maybe even make some valuable connections within the firearm community. Navigating the 2024 Leesburg Armory Gun Show: What to Buy and What to Skip
Alright, let's talk strategy for the Leesburg Armory Gun Show Schedule 2024. You're there, you're ready, but what should you be keeping an eye out for, and what might be better left on the table? This is where smart shopping comes in, guys. When it comes to buying, focus on items where the value proposition at a gun show is highest. Firearms, especially if you can physically inspect them, handle them, and negotiate a price, are often great buys. Look for deals on common models, or if you're a collector, keep an eye out for those rare, hard-to-find pieces that dealers might be bringing specifically to the show. Ammunition is another big one. While online prices can be competitive, bulk ammo deals at shows can sometimes offer significant savings, especially if you're buying larger quantities. Just be sure to check the quality and brand. Accessories are also prime territory. Holsters, lights, lasers, grips, cleaning kits, and gun safes can often be found at competitive prices, and you can physically examine the quality and fit before purchasing. Reloading supplies, like powder, primers, and dies, are often well-stocked and can present good value for handloaders. Knives and survival gear are also frequently featured and can offer great deals. Now, what about skipping? Be cautious with highly specialized or custom firearms unless you are an absolute expert in that specific niche and have done extensive research. While they can be amazing, prices can also be astronomical, and the risk of buying a lemon is higher if you're not intimately familiar with the maker. Generic, unbranded accessories are often best avoided. While they might be cheap, their quality can be questionable, leading to potential failures or breakage down the line. Stick to reputable brands or items you can thoroughly inspect. Be wary of deals that seem too good to be true. If a brand-new, high-end rifle is being sold for half its retail price, there's usually a catch – it could be stolen, a counterfeit, or have hidden defects. Always trust your gut and do your due diligence. Also, don't buy the first thing you see. Part of the fun and benefit of a gun show is the comparison shopping. Walk around, see what other vendors have, and get a feel for the market price before committing. Unless it’s a truly unique, one-of-a-kind item you know you'll never find again, it’s usually worth taking your time.
